hortatory

 

Definitions from WordNet

Adjective hortatory has 1 sense
  1. exhortative, exhortatory, hortative, hortatory - giving strong encouragement
    Antonym: discouraging (indirect, via encouraging)

Hortatory

Part of Speech:

Adjective

Definition (sense 1):

Giving strong encouragement or advice; urging earnestly or fervently.

Example Sentences:

1. The coach gave a hortatory speech to motivate the team before the championship game.

2. The hortatory tone of the politician's speech inspired the crowd.

Definition (sense 2):

Of or relating to exhortation; urging or calling to action.

Example Sentences:

1. The hortatory letter from the organization urged its members to participate in the charity event.

2. The teacher used hortatory language to encourage the students to think critically about the issue.
